Understanding Due Process: Your Constitutional Shield

The Fifth and Fourteenth Amendments to the U.S. Constitution guarantee “due process of law,” a cornerstone of American justice. This prevents the government – at federal, state, or local levels – from depriving you of life, liberty, or property without it. This isn’t just a formality; it’s a fundamental right ensuring fairness and preventing arbitrary government action.

Due process has two key aspects: procedural and substantive. Procedural due process focuses on the fairness of the process used by the government. It demands that the government follows established laws and provides fair procedures before taking action against you, even if those procedures aren’t explicitly spelled out in a law.

Substantive due process, on the other hand, is about the substance of the government’s actions. It protects fundamental rights, even if those rights aren’t explicitly listed in the Constitution. This aspect is more complex and often involves interpreting the Constitution’s broad guarantees to protect fundamental rights and liberties. The courts have interpreted substantive due process to cover issues ranging from the right to marry to the right to raise children.

Navigating the Complexity of Due Process Claims

Determining when due process applies is not always straightforward. It requires careful legal analysis. The government’s actions must be against you “on individual grounds,” based on specific characteristics rather than general laws. State action is also vital; private entities generally don’t fall under the Due Process Clause.

While there’s no single checklist for due process, it typically involves:

  • An unbiased tribunal or decision-maker
  • Adequate notice of the charges or actions against you
  • A chance to present your side of the story and evidence
  • A reasoned decision based on the evidence presented

The key is the balance between individual rights and the government’s interests. This balance is often determined on a case-by-case basis, using a framework set by the Supreme Court.

What is a Section 1983 action, and how does it relate to due process?

Section 1983 of Title 42 of the U.S. Code allows individuals to sue state officials who violate their constitutional rights. Many Section 1983 cases involve allegations of due process violations, either procedural (unfair procedures) or substantive (violation of fundamental rights).
